OCD is characterized by intrusive, distressing thoughts and compulsions to perform repetitive behaviors like checking or cleaning. It affects 1-3% of the population and causes significant impairment. In contrast, obsessive-compulsive personality disorder involves rigid, ego-syntonic thoughts and habits that the person does not find abnormal.
